Technical Field

The invention relates to the field of textile production, in particular to a ready-made clothes dryer for textile production.

Background

The natural airing is influenced by weather more heavily, and normal clothing factory equipment is equipped with the drying-machine, can play the effect of fast drying. The dryer heats air by using a heat source, changes the air into hot air for drying operation, and makes the hot air continuously contact with clothes containing moisture, so that the moisture on the fabric is gradually evaporated, and the aim of quick drying is fulfilled.

The existing ready-made clothes drying equipment for clothes production generates peculiar smell in the production process, seriously pollutes the environment and is not beneficial to the sustainable development of production; meanwhile, clothes are not dried comprehensively, the production efficiency is seriously affected, some dryers are driven by adopting a driving motor to drive clothes to rotate, so that the aim of drying uniformly is fulfilled, the loss of energy sources is increased by using the driving motor, the energy-saving large direction is violated, the existing dryers do not have a shaking function, and the drying efficiency can be greatly reduced if water drops which can fall off exist on the clothes.
